The DSC had our second Tech Petting Zoo yesterday, and this time we made it into the local news (video below)! The idea has been to provide a hands-on showcase of the various tools and services available from UVic Libraries.

We hauled out a wide range of items, such as: a 3D printer, Arduino and Raspberry Pi kits, a VR headset, a 360 camera, a GoPro kit, calipers, laptops, a graphics tablet, and a video display to showcase the available green screen room. The star of the show was the 3D printer — something  many people had not been able to see in action before.

Having access to technology is exciting, but it can be intimidating to get started on your own. So, many people were happy to learn about our free workshop, too.
